Bouw Vertrouwen met Spreekvaardigheidsoefeningen

Vloeiend en zelfverzekerd Engels spreken is een doel voor veel leerlingen, of het nu voor reizen, werk of sociale interacties is. De spreekvaardigheidsquizzen van Engels Examen Leren helpen je je uitspraak, klemtoon en gespreksvaardigheden te verbeteren. Van formele begroetingen tot het aanvullen van dialogen, onze quizzen simuleren echte gespreksituaties. Elke vraag bevat uitleg om je te helpen uitspraakregels of beleefde uitdrukkingen te begrijpen, zodat je natuurlijk kunt communiceren. Of je je voorbereidt op een sollicitatiegesprek, een presentatie of een reis naar het buitenland, onze spreekvaardigheidsquizzen helpen je om vloeiender en zelfverzekerder te spreken.
